Output 0186aa8dbb703e2ca85639e5bd439d112db3db1b22e7eea1977e025a91fda3d9:86

value
115725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5ebaf0f6744d77b19e795b0e776404be436a987 OP_EQUAL
address
3Q7Kp9AypLr5Yzk9XjNJhzoP2PAAcN9qNm
transaction
0186aa8dbb703e2ca85639e5bd439d112db3db1b22e7eea1977e025a91fda3d9
confirmations
172064
spent
true